Childish Gambino reveals tracklist for final album

Childish Gambino has revealed the tracklist of his upcoming fifth studio album. After announcing that this one will be the last under his rap name, the record, titled Bando Stone & the New World, will no doubt hold a special place in his fans’ hearts.

Bando Stone & the New World will be Gambino’s second album of 2024. In May, he released Atavista, a reissued version of his 2020 record 3.15.20. However to Gambino, this take was the “finished version”, finally allowing him to put that album to bed now it felt complete in the form he wanted it to be in.

Completing that project appears to have opened the floodgates of his creativity, as his next album, Bando Stone & the New World, is coming only three months later. That influx of energy for his artistic vision hasn’t only translated into music either, as the new album will also provide a soundtrack for a film of the same name.

A trailer for the movie revealed the plot and the themes that are expected to surface on the album. It’s a futuristic dystopia as Gambino takes on the titular role of Bando Stone, a singer stumbling into a post-apocalyptic world. He then teams up with a woman and her son to fight prehistoric creatures and try to escape from an unexplained phenomena that seems to delete “chunks” of the world.

The album’s first single, ‘Lithonia’, revealed a very different sound for the artist as it strayed into more pop-punk or rock waters. It’s clear that this is a moment of total artistic reshaping for Gambino, leaving a big question mark hanging over what this new album might sound like as he prepares to finally leave behind his moniker and start something totally fresh.

Now, he’s revealed the tracklist for the album, giving a slight insight into what can be expected. The record features plenty of collaborations with artists, including Jorja Smith, Chlöe, Flo Milli and the psychedelic rock troupe Khruangbin. Amaarae also features on the album twice, already heard on the single ‘In The Night’ as well as being featured on the upcoming track, ‘Talk My Shit’.

However, some of Gambino’s regular collaborators are missing. Steve Lacy and Kamasi Washington both attended the Bando Stone listening party. It was reported that Lacy had worked on the song ‘Step’s Beach,’ while Washington provided horns on a track called ‘Survivor.’ Neither are listed as featured artists, so perhaps there are more names of note to come when the full personnel of the album is revealed, allowing fans to see who contributed to the music across the record but isn’t credited as a full feature.

Bando Stone & the New World is set for release on July 19th, 2024.
